Apple TV+
MLS
Search
Apple TV+
Apple TV+
MLS
Search
Sign In
IW
Izaac Wang
Izaac Wang is an American actor best known for his performances in Good Boys, Raya and the Last Dragon, and Dìdi.
WIKIPEDIA
Movies
Shows
Credited For